DDC Chairpersons placed equivalent to Administrative Secretaries, IGPs

The administration of J&K UT amended its warrant of precedence, placing Chairpersons of DDCs equal to Administrative Secretaries.

J&K admin amends protocols for BDC chairpersons

On Wednesday, the administration amended rules to give Block Development Council (BDC) chairpersons in Jammu and Kashmir a status equivalent to that of Army brigadier.
